Default I'm sure most of you thought this day would never come, but I finally upgraded fueling!

I decided to go with Bluetops@5bar (~488cc/min) and a RS4 MAF converted for use with Hitachi sensor. Thanks to Piggie and Poppa Piggie for the kickass parts. It's unreal how stock looking the entire setup is, especially the airbox to MAF housing connection. Here is a picture:



Of course, I did some preliminary testing. Piggie thought I was crazy testing and tweaking in the rain, but I couldn't help myself. After spending a little while tweaking, I decided on these Lemmi settings:



I still need to pull more fuel, as evidenced by the graphs to follow, but other than that the car feels absolutely great. The car still drives and idles exactly like it did on stock injectors. The only difference I've noticed is a more pronounced whoosh coming from the intake (stock airbox with stock filter and darintake hole).

Default I am MBC only actually. I really like the MBC only setup.

I am running X chip with 5% primary fuel pulled back and 1.5 degrees of timing added, yes.

I went with Bluetops instead of RS4 injectors purely because of price. I purchased 8 Blutop injectors for $175 shipped, about the price of 1-2 RS4 injectors.
